This is not exsactly head line news, everyone knows no matter how much money you pour into security nothing is 100% fool proof working everytime.

I seen a hour long report just on this subject on MSNBC last night, NBC Editors and producers actually were Hired in secuirty posts with no back ground check or training at two different US airports and by the same security company.

were able to gain access even to plane cabins and cockpits No question asked.

Were Checking bagage not by opening the bags all the way up but just partly unzipping and sticking there hand in in plan view of supiorvisors could have just as well been putting something in the bag as well as check to make sure something wasn't there.

Its not the security put in place that don't work it would work if the companies doing the hireing would do there reasearch and jobs the way they should.

Problem is most security personnel are paid min wage or just above the turn over is fast and there main objective is just to have another warm body to fill the opening ....
